πΌ Finance Associate Job in Dubai β Key Responsibilities
- Prepare customer invoices accurately and ensure all supporting documentation is complete.
- Track discrepancies between supervisory data and invoices issued.
- Maintain records of payments received and ensure correct allocation of funds.
- Support receivables reconciliation and monitor payment collections.
- Issue invoices related to late submissions or late payment fees.
- Manage procurement activities including purchase requisitions and purchase orders.
- Process travel and training requests according to internal authority matrices.
- Maintain procurement records and validate supporting documentation.
- Reconcile purchasing credit card statements and verify receipts.
- Escalate discrepancies related to financial transactions and procurement records.
- Enter financial data accurately into Microsoft Dynamics 365.
- Maintain petty cash records and conduct monthly and quarterly cash counts.
- Support supplier and customer account reconciliations.
- Prepare financial reports and assist the finance team with administrative tasks.
π― Required Skills & Qualifications
- Bachelorβs deg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related discipline.
- 4β6 years of experience in finance, procurement, or accounting roles.
- Strong knowledge of accounts payable, accounts receivable, and financial procedures.
- Experience working within multinational or regulated organizations.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el.
- Exper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 is highly desirable.
- Strong attention to detail and analytical thinking.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ams.
- Proactive approach to process improvement and operational efficiency.
